The Department of Byzantine and Modern Greek Studies of the University of Cologne is seeking to appoint a research assistant in the framework of the project “Creating a Sustainable Digital Infrastructure for Research-Based Teaching in Byzantine Studies” funded by the Volkswagen Foundation (more information on the project herehttps://ifa.phil-fak.uni-koeln.de/forschung/byzantinistik-und-neugriechische-philologie-forschung/drittmittel-projekte/dibs-digital-byzantine-studies). The successful candidate will work towards obtaining a PhD degree. The position is to be filled part time (65 %, 25,89 hours per week) from April 1st, 2023, for three years. The salary will correspond to TV-L 13 as specified in the Public Sector Collective Agreement.
The application period ends on January 15th, 2023. Interviews will take place via Zoom on February 2nd, 2023.
